1.2 Scientific Inquiry22
variable: a quantity that is measured or changed in an experiment or observation.
experimental variable: the single variable that is changed to test its effect.
control variable: variables that are kept constant.

1.2 Scientific Inquiry24
error: the unavoidable difference between a real measurement and the unknown true value of the quantity being measured.
• Measurements always contain some uncertainty or error.
• In this case, error is not a mistake.
Error and uncertainty

1.2 Scientific Inquiry31
0.6 seconds
Estimated error: +/– 4 seconds
Estimated error: +/– 4 seconds
No, the difference in time (0.6 s) is not significant, because it is smaller than the
estimated error (4 s).
Does sugar dissolve slower in warmer water?
